Science Activities for Every Year Level
What do the Teach Starter science teaching resources cover for each year level? We're so glad you asked!
Whether you're teaching year 1 or year 6 (or any year level in between), we have got you covered. Take a look at what's in store for your classroom.
Foundation Year
- Living Things — Teach Starter science resources cover the characteristics and needs of living things, including plants and animals.
- Materials — Explore different materials and their properties, such as solid objects and water, with your students.
- Weather — We provide the resources you need to work with students to observe and describe weather conditions and patterns, including temperature and rainfall.
Year 1
- Living Things—Use Teach Starter's pre-made lesson and unit plans to investigate the diversity of living things, including plants and animals, and their life cycles.
- Materials — Explore the properties and uses of everyday materials, including how they can change.
- Earth and Space Sciences — Examine the natural and human-made features of your local environment.
Year 2
- Biological Sciences — Explore the needs and characteristics of living things and how they depend on their environment.
- Chemical Sciences — Investigate the properties and changes of materials, including mixtures and how they can be separated.
- Earth and Space Sciences — Teach your class about the observable changes in the sky and natural disasters.
Year 3
- Life Cycles— Study the life cycles of plants and animals, including the influence of the environment.
- Properties — Investigate the properties of different materials and how they can change through heating and cooling.
- Earth's Rotation and Revolutions — Explore the movement of the Earth, including seasons and the night sky.
Year 4
- Ecosystems and Adaptations — Examine the interdependence of living things within ecosystems and their adaptations to the environment.
- Heat Energy — Investigate the transfer of energy through different sources and how it can be transformed.
- Rocks and Resources — Teach your science students about the rock cycle, natural resources and the changing Earth's surface with a host of teaching resources designed for year 4.
Year 5
- Plant Reproduction and the Human Body — Study the lifecycle of living things, including plant reproduction and human body systems with your year 5 class.
- Chemical Sciences — Use our science experiment teaching resources to investigate the properties of substances and how they interact, including reversible and irreversible changes.
- Earth and Space Sciences — Take your students on an exploration of the Earth's rotation, the solar system and the importance of water as a resource.
Year 6
- Biological Sciences — Use Teach Starter's science resources to examine the classification of living things — including microorganisms — and explore how they can affect human health.
- Physical Sciences — Use our science experiments and worksheets to investigate the transfer of electricity and the properties of light, including how it enables sight.
- Earth and Space Sciences — Explore the Earth's place in the universe, including the solar system, galaxies and the Big Bang Theory.
